| // The call sequence start/end LLVM-isms isn't useful to WebAssembly since it's |
| // a virtual ISA. |
| let isCodeGenOnly = 1 in { |
| def : I<(outs), (ins i64imm:$amt), |
| [(WebAssemblycallseq_start timm:$amt)]>; |
| def : I<(outs), (ins i64imm:$amt1, i64imm:$amt2), |
| [(WebAssemblycallseq_end timm:$amt1, timm:$amt2)]>; |
| } // isCodeGenOnly = 1 |
| |
| multiclass CALL<WebAssemblyRegClass vt> { |
| def CALL_#vt : I<(outs vt:$dst), (ins global:$callee, variable_ops), |
| [(set vt:$dst, (WebAssemblycall1 (WebAssemblywrapper tglobaladdr:$callee)))]>; |
| def CALL_INDIRECT_#vt : I<(outs vt:$dst), (ins I32:$callee, variable_ops), |
| [(set vt:$dst, (WebAssemblycall1 I32:$callee))]>; |
| } |
| let Uses = [SP32, SP64], isCall = 1 in { |
| defm : CALL<I32>; |
| defm : CALL<I64>; |
| defm : CALL<F32>; |
| defm : CALL<F64>; |
| |
| def CALL_VOID : I<(outs), (ins global:$callee, variable_ops), |
| [(WebAssemblycall0 (WebAssemblywrapper tglobaladdr:$callee))]>; |
| def CALL_INDIRECT_VOID : I<(outs), (ins I32:$callee, variable_ops), |
| [(WebAssemblycall0 I32:$callee)]>; |
| } // Uses = [SP32,SP64], isCall = 1 |
